AJAX 问题 - 新手

问题描述 投票:0回答:1

我的网页中有一个 HTML 文本框,没有提交按钮。

<form>
<label>Website URL: </label>
<input name="" type="text" class="textfield" />
</form>

文本框用于输入url,我需要使用AJAX对此文本框进行验证。例如,如果有人输入url并按回车键,则URL将出现在文本框下方,并且文本框将再次清空。仅当它是有效形成的 url 时,它才会执行此操作,例如,如果有人编写 ttjkl.145,则不会执行任何操作,因为它不是有效的 url。但是,它将接受任何有效的变体,例如 http://www.url.com 或 www.url.co.uk 和 url.com.au。它会删除国家/地区代码末尾之后的任何内容,例如,如果该人输入 www.abc.net/dlkjfk,则仅接受 www.abc.net

javascript
1个回答
0
投票

你需要的与Ajax无关。仅 JavaScript 就可以满足您的需要。

您寻求的答案已经存在:

URL 正则表达式验证

帮助我验证应该接受 .me 域名的网址

如何使用正则表达式验证 javascript 中的 url

© www.soinside.com 2019 - 2024. All rights reserved.